This question shows a severe fundemental lack of understanding about tournament poker.

What exactly is your thought process for justifying a call and getting it in on a "safe" flop?

What do you think his UTG+2 raising range is? Which of those hands is he calling a pf shove with? What do you think his continuation bet frequency will be when he whiffs his pocket pair on an ace high flop?... I could keep going but it seems like you are not thinking critically but instead you are thinking about how many times he flops an ace with his AK vs. your QQ.

I'll give you a hint, you are losing because you only have 4,720 chips left because you call too much and wait for safe flops. You are losing because you don't have people covered when you do race with QQ vs. AK and you can't afford to lose the flip (with a nice overlay as a favorite). You are not losing because you got your money in as a favorite against his range and just got 'unlucky'
